To pronounce "ocker", say OCK-er — 2 syllables, IPA /ˈɒkə/. Tap play below to hear it in four English accents, or practice it syllable by syllable.

"ocker" has 2 syllables: ock-er. It rhymes with knocker and rocker, if that helps it stick.
Sounds exactly like: aaker — easy to mix up when writing.

Ocker: Interest on money; usury; increase.
